Tamrac Velocity 6x review

Camera bags needn't make a fashion statement, but this one's bland design borders on the ugly.
There's room for an SLR camera and small accessories such as a charger and spare battery. Side pockets at the front and inside the lid provide room for memory cards, a mobile phone and other small items. The sling design means that it can be kept out of the way like a backpack, while providing quick access simply by swinging the back around to the wearer's front.
Adjustable internal padding ensures a snug fit, suspending the camera with its lens pointing down. The average kit lens won't reach the bottom of the bag and is very well protected from knocks. However, we'd recommend adding a little extra padding at the bottom when carrying a longer zoom lens so it isn't in direct contact with the bottom of the bag, which is a little thin.
It's hard to get excited about the bland-looking Velocity 6, but it serves its purpose well and is attractively priced.
